    They aren't getting an on-campus arena. There is nowhere to build one on campus. They had the opportunity in the 80s and 90s but have since developed the land. Fun fact, the owner of the Wiz and Capitals, who also owns the arena where they and Georgetown play is a Georgetown alum. Now, it gets interesting with his plan to move build a new arena in Northern Virginia. Would Georgetown really move their home games there? I *SERIOUSLY* doubt this. Where does that leave Georgetown? The District of Columbia wouldn't keep the stadium and would probably turn it into housing, so Georgetown really wouldn't have a home court outside of the like 728 year-old McDonaugh Arena

    Honestly, I am not sold that Capital one Arena is the cause for a bad atmosphere. I believe the weak non conference scheduling is what is really hurting this team. I've been going to games since I was a kid and ive seen G-town pack that arena out. I remember back in the late 2000's Duke came to Cap one arena and the place was close to sold out... even Obama was sitting courtside (Gtown won the game as well). But with the weakness of the scheduling I don't see why casual fans would want to attend, and why would be name recruits want to play for Gtown. To me thats the real reason why the program is sinking. Cooley is trying to turn things around though, Im rooting for him. #HoyaSaxa
